Through this technique it is possible to determine separately the ambipolar diffusion length (L*) and the effective lifetime (τ*) of the generated carriers, using either Schottky diodes or quasi-ohmic sandwich structures. We also report a new static method based on the Spectral Photovoltage (SPT) that allows to infer the ambipolar diffusion length and to estimate the surface recombination velocity. © 1991 Elsevier Science Publishers B.V.
